Time to Prepare for 2016

December 28, 2015

Happy holidays! As you prepare for the new year, it's a good time to make sure that you have updated your Statement of Organization ( FEC Form 1 (Instructions)) to reflect any changes (e.g., staffing, mailing address, email address). Also, review your FECMail subscriptions to ensure that you're getting the latest information as soon as it's posted. January will bring updated reporting schedules, announcements of outreach opportunities, updated coordinated party expenditure limits and postings of other important information for committee treasurers.
